Dune Preserve is multi leveled/winged restaurant/bar, wich appears to be quite alternative to other places in Anguilla. The owner Bankie Banx built it of old and broken parts of boats, trees and such. It is funny that after a hurricane he would just gather the broken parts back together withough having to spend on new materials.
Do not mean to deminish this place and its owner in any way - on the contrary it is a decent, although some wold say - a funky place, which is quite popular on the island, and a definite must see for the the visitors. Anguilla is one of the most expensive islands in the Caribbean where all kinds of big titles and stars have houses or come for an escape holiday. This place is different and charming, standing next to one of the rich hotels Cuisine Art on the Rendezvous Bay, facing the neighbour island St.Martin.
